Further note: I have undone your changes at Template:UK-academic-bio-stub. You unfortunately tried to create an article in a template, which is the wrong way to do it - that particular template is used on lots of articles to show that the information is about a UK academic and can be expanded. Your changes meant that, for a while, every article using the template was displaying your notes about Edith Hall! If you want to create an article about an academic, and you think that they are sufficiently notable (check the guidance at Wikipedia:Notability (academics)) then go ahead - but on a new page, not in a template!
